Abstract

Introduce the methodologies and steps for the involute straight cone gear in environment of Pro/E 3.0.Based on principle,using equation build up the involute.Consequently we can ensure the accuracy of the involute gear shape.The designer only needs to input the gear parameters,then three dimensional entity models may be created rapidly and precisely with the efficiency of design upgraded.And dynamic simulation is executed by using mechanism module,The foundation for further designing manufacturing and engineering analysis are also established.
